      We have a new client using WP with the Google Translate Plugin. This is the plugin where you choose the flag, the language, etc. https://wordpress.org/plugins/google-language-translator/

      If you are an SEO who has done some international SEO over a period of time, I have a question. I know how to handle when not using a Google Translator Plugin but am curious about if we are using it.

      Obviously, the client wants to be able to target all countries in the americas so it is important. They have the following languages on the site via the plugin: Portuguese, Spanish, French. They are using the Flags of Spain, Portugal, and France to denote language choices.

      I am wondering if we are using that would we be wise to include hreflang attributes for language as well. I am fairly certain that we do not need to put in a -ES for every Spanish speaking country in South America, etc. and can simply go with the -ES for the language designation, but am open to others ideas on this.

        First off, reconsider using flags as languages.

        Secondly, if your content is auto-translated, you shouldn't index it (so don't use hreflang). Per Google:

        Use robots.txt to block search engines from crawling automatically translated pages on your site. Automated translations don’t always make sense and could be viewed as spam. More importantly, a poor or artificial-sounding translation can harm your site’s perception.
